Table of Contents

How to Recover TwinDB | Quick-Fix Tutorial

How to Recover TwinDB

“We are a legal service organization intensely working on a major case. However, when using the TwinDB InnoDB database, we found that some of the evidence records for April 5 to April 7 were missing, making correlations between related evidence broken. 

The database was routinely upgraded on April 7. We have checked the database logs and found that there were abnormal interruptions during the upgrade. We tried to restore from the most recent backup, but it did not contain new data for April 5 to April 7. 

There is an urgent need to recover TwinDB database to the state of the data as of 23:59 on April 7, to ensure that the lost evidence records are intact and the associations are correctly reconstructed.”

TwinDB is a high-performance and highly reliable database management system that is widely used in various business scenarios. However, in some cases, TwinDB database may suffer from corruption or data loss. At this point, how to recover TwinDB database becomes a critical issue. In this article, we will introduce how to recover TwinDB database in detail, including the recovery process, methods and precautions.

What Causes TwinDB Data Loss in MySQL

TwinDB is a specialized tool for InnoDB data recovery, it also has a name undrop for InnoDB, which can help users recover data and table structure in case of database corruption or data loss. When MySQL fails to start, the TwinDB toolset can recover MySQL table structures directly from the system tablespace file ibdata1. TwinDB can also recover data from the InnoDB storage engine, including table data, indexes, triggers, stored procedures, and so on.

In some cases, TwinDB database may suffer from corruption or loss of data. This may be due to hardware failure, software error, human error, etc. 

Hardware Failure

lDisk failure

lPower failure

lOther hardware component failures

Operating System Failure

lSystem crash

lFile system error

lSoftware update or patch problems

Human Factor

lMisoperation

lImproper management of privileges

lBackup or recovery operation errors

Software Failure

lMySQL software defects

lPlug-in or middleware problems

lConfiguration error

Network Problems

lNetwork interruptions

lNetwork security attacks

TwinDB database is the foundation of many organizations’ important business systems. If the database fails or data is lost, it may have a serious impact on the business continuity of the organization. Therefore, timely recovery of TwinDB database is essential to maintain business continuity.

In order to recover the lost data, appropriate recovery measures need to be taken. Here are three main effective methods are offered below.

3 Fixes: How to Effectively Recover TwinDB Database

 

Fix 1: Through Physical Recovery

If the TwinDB database is corrupted due to hardware failure or disaster, physical recovery methods can be used. This includes restoring data from backups, rebuilding database files, and so on.

Fix 2: Via Logical Recovery

If the TwinDB database is corrupted due to a logical error or human error, logical recovery methods can be used. This includes recovering data from log files, repairing data files, etc.

Fix 3: Using MTM Database Recovery

MTM Database Recovery software is a professional database recovery tool that recovers data from corrupted or lost TwinDB InnoDB databases. MTM Database Recovery software has an intuitive user interface that makes it easy for users to operate and master the recovery process. In addition, the software also provides professional technical support and services to help users in resolving issues during the recovery process.

It provides a range of solutions for TwinDB InnoDB database recovery. The following are the specific steps to recover TwinDB with MTM Database Recovery software:

Step 1: Download and install MTM Database Recovery software. Go with the version for MySQL.

Step 2: Launch MTM Database Recovery software and select the “Recovery” button on the top. Select the file where the TwinDB database you want to recover is located.

Select TwinDB Database

Check the “Recover deleted data” option and click “Recover” to start TwinDB recovery.

Step 3: Start the recovery process. Please note that it may take some time depending on the size and complexity of the database.

Step 4: After the recovery is complete, you can select the files you need to recover on the left side of the software and preview the details of the selected files on the right side.

Preview Recovered TwinDB Data

Step 5: Click the “Export” button on the top of the software to export the recovered TwinDB database data to a database or save it as a CSV file.

Export to Database

Export to CSV

For Enterprise

Physical recovery can directly operate on the underlying data files with fast speed, and it applies to serious failures or data file corruption. Downtime of operation may be required, affecting business continuity. Online recovery can be performed without affecting business operations with logical recovery. However, it may take longer for large amounts of data or complex transactions. Professional recovery tool supports multiple database types and failure scenarios with high adaptability.

For Government/Judicial Sector/Legal Organization/Etc

Physical recovery can maximize data originality. Government and other departments usually have a comprehensive backup system and disaster recovery plan to facilitate physical recovery. It is favorable to meet the requirements of “point-in-time recovery” with logical recovery. However, it may not be fully recoverable if binary logs are lost or corrupted. Recovery tools can effectively improve recovery efficiency and reduce the burden on technicians. Their deep scanning and fragmentation help to cope with complex data loss problems.

*Based on the actual problem, seek your corresponding method to solve it.

Other Suggestions for TwinDB Recovery

 

    • Regular backups: To ensure that data can be restored in a timely manner in the event of a failure, it is recommended that backups be created on a regular basis. Also, ensure that backup files are stored in a safe location to prevent accidental deletion or corruption.
    • Monitoring and maintenance: Regularly monitor the operation status and performance indicators of TwinDB database. Identify and resolve potential problems in a timely manner to avoid the risk of data loss or corruption.
    • Choose the right recovery tool: When choosing a recovery tool, consider factors such as its functionality, performance and reliability. Ensure that the tool selected meets business requirements and supports fast and accurate data recovery.
    • Training and support: Train database administrators to improve their understanding and operation of recovery technologies such as TwinDB. At the same time, provide technical support and after-sales service to ensure that problems can be solved in a timely manner.

Summary

This article describes in detail how to recover TwinDB database processes and methods, including the recovery process, methods and precautions. By understanding and using these techniques, enterprises can quickly and accurately recover damaged TwinDB databases to ensure business continuity and data integrity.

In practice, care should be taken to regularly back up, monitor and maintain the database, select appropriate recovery tools and provide training and support for them. This will help reduce the risk of data loss and improve the operational efficiency of your organization.